About Robert Hayden

Robert Earl Hayden (August 4, 1913 – February 25, 1980), born Asa Bundy Sheffey, was an American poet, essayist, and educator. From 1976 to 1978, Hayden was Consultant in Poetry to the Library of Congress, the position which in 1985 became the Poet Laureate Consultant in Poetry to the Library of Congress.
